Bug#323093: marked as done (arson: FTBFS: ISO C++ forbids declaration of 'KXMLGUIClient' with no type)
Your message dated Wed, 17 Aug 2005 03:13:25 -0700
with message-id <E1E5KvF-0007ny-00@spohr.debian.org>
and subject line Bug#317543: fixed in kdelibs 4:3.4.2-1
has caused the attached Bug report to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ere.  Please contact me immediately.)
Debian bug tracking system administrator
(administrator, Debian Bugs database)
--------------------------------------
Received: (at submit) by bugs.debian.org; 9 Jul 2005 14:52:08 +0000
>From kurt@roeckx.be Sat Jul 09 07:52:08 2005
Return-path: <kurt@roeckx.be>
Received: from smtp-2.hut.fi [130.233.228.92] 
	by spohr.debian.org with esmtp (Exim 3.35 1 (Debian))
	id 1DrGga-0006MX-00; Sat, 09 Jul 2005 07:52:08 -0700
Received: from localhost (katosiko.hut.fi [130.233.228.115])
	by smtp-2.hut.fi (8.12.10/8.12.10) with ESMTP id j69Epb8Y007768
	for <submit@bugs.debian.org>; Sat, 9 Jul 2005 17:51:37 +0300
Received: from smtp-2.hut.fi ([130.233.228.92])
 by localhost (katosiko.hut.fi [130.233.228.115]) (amavisd-new, port 10024)
 with LMTP id 22610-07 for <submit@bugs.debian.org>;
 Sat,  9 Jul 2005 17:51:36 +0300 (EEST)
Received: from dhcp-4-241.debconf5.net (a130-233-4-241.debconf5.hut.fi [130.233.4.241])
	by smtp-2.hut.fi (8.12.10/8.12.10) with ESMTP id j69Ehwte006789
	for <submit@bugs.debian.org>; Sat, 9 Jul 2005 17:43:58 +0300
Subject: arson: FTBFS: ISO C++ forbids declaration of 'KXMLGUIClient' with
	no type
From: Kurt Roeckx <kurt@roeckx.be>
To: submit@bugs.debian.org
Content-Type: text/plain
Date: Sat, 09 Jul 2005 16:44:20 +0200
Message-Id: <1120920260.4164.20.camel@localhost.localdomain>
Mime-Version: 1.0
X-Mailer: Evolution 2.0.4 
Content-Transfer-Encoding: 7bit
X-TKK-Virus-Scanned: by amavisd-new-2.1.2-hutcc at katosiko.hut.fi
Delivered-To: submit@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2005_01_02 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Status: No, hits=-8.0 required=4.0 tests=BAYES_00,HAS_PACKAGE 
	autolearn=no version=2.60-bugs.debian.org_2005_01_02
X-Spam-Level: 
Package: arson
Version: 0.9.8beta2-4
Severity: serious
Hi,
Your package is failing to build with the following error:
source='arson.cpp' object='arson.o' libtool=no \
depfile='.deps/arson.Po' tmpdepfile='.deps/arson.TPo' \
depmode=gcc3 /bin/sh ../admin/depcomp \
i486-linux-gnu-g++ -DHAVE_CONFIG_H -I. -I. -I.. -I/usr/include/kde
-I/usr/include/qt3 -I.   -DQT_THREAD_SUPPORT  -D_REENTRANT  -pipe -O2
-DNDEBUG -fno-check-new -DOGG -DFLAC  -c -o arson.o `test -f arson.cpp
|| echo './'`arson.cpp
/usr/include/kde/kactioncollection.h:242: error: ISO C++ forbids
declaration of 'KXMLGUIClient' with no type
/usr/include/kde/kactioncollection.h:242: error: expected ';' before '*'
token
/usr/include/kde/kactioncollection.h:345: error: expected ',' or '...'
before '*' token
/usr/include/kde/kactioncollection.h:345: error: ISO C++ forbids
declaration of 'KXMLGUIClient' with no type
arson.cpp: In function 'void arsonNotify(const QString&)':
arson.cpp:329: warning: 'event' is deprecated (declared
at /usr/include/kde/knotifyclient.h:195)
arson.cpp: In member function 'void ArsonRadioDlg::addItem(const
QString&)':
arson.cpp:662: warning: 'moveItem' is deprecated (declared
at /usr/include/kde/klistview.h:163)
make[4]: *** [arson.o] Error 1
This might be a bug in kdelibs-dev package.  If you think so, please
clone and reassign.
Kurt
---------------------------------------
Received: (at 317543-close) by bugs.debian.org; 17 Aug 2005 10:23:48 +0000
>From joerg@spohr.debian.org Wed Aug 17 03:23:48 2005
Return-path: <joerg@spohr.debian.org>
Received: from joerg by spohr.debian.org with local (Exim 3.36 1 (Debian))
	id 1E5KvF-0007ny-00; Wed, 17 Aug 2005 03:13:25 -0700
From: Debian Qt/KDE Maintainers <debian-qt-kde@lists.debian.org>
To: 317543-close@bugs.debian.org
X-Katie: lisa $Revision: 1.30 $
Subject: Bug#317543: fixed in kdelibs 4:3.4.2-1
Message-Id: <E1E5KvF-0007ny-00@spohr.debian.org>
Sender: Joerg Jaspert <joerg@spohr.debian.org>
Date: Wed, 17 Aug 2005 03:13:25 -0700
Delivered-To: 317543-close@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2005_01_02 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Level: 
X-Spam-Status: No, hits=-6.0 required=4.0 tests=BAYES_00,HAS_BUG_NUMBER 
	autolearn=no version=2.60-bugs.debian.org_2005_01_02
X-CrossAssassin-Score: 13
Source: kdelibs
Source-Version: 4:3.4.2-1
We believe that the bug you reported is fixed in the latest version of
kdelibs, which is due to be installed in the Debian FTP archive:
kdelibs-bin_3.4.2-1_i386.deb
  to pool/main/k/kdelibs/kdelibs-bin_3.4.2-1_i386.deb
kdelibs-data_3.4.2-1_all.deb
  to pool/main/k/kdelibs/kdelibs-data_3.4.2-1_all.deb
kdelibs4-dev_3.4.2-1_i386.deb
  to pool/main/k/kdelibs/kdelibs4-dev_3.4.2-1_i386.deb
kdelibs4-doc_3.4.2-1_all.deb
  to pool/main/k/kdelibs/kdelibs4-doc_3.4.2-1_all.deb
kdelibs4c2-dbg_3.4.2-1_i386.deb
  to pool/main/k/kdelibs/kdelibs4c2-dbg_3.4.2-1_i386.deb
kdelibs4c2_3.4.2-1_i386.deb
  to pool/main/k/kdelibs/kdelibs4c2_3.4.2-1_i386.deb
kdelibs_3.4.2-1.diff.gz
  to pool/main/k/kdelibs/kdelibs_3.4.2-1.diff.gz
kdelibs_3.4.2-1.dsc
  to pool/main/k/kdelibs/kdelibs_3.4.2-1.dsc
kdelibs_3.4.2-1_all.deb
  to pool/main/k/kdelibs/kdelibs_3.4.2-1_all.deb
kdelibs_3.4.2.orig.tar.gz
  to pool/main/k/kdelibs/kdelibs_3.4.2.orig.tar.gz
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 317543@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Debian Qt/KDE Maintainers <debian-qt-kde@lists.debian.org> (supplier of updated kdelibs package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Format: 1.7
Date: Tue, 16 Aug 2005 11:16:00 -0400
Source: kdelibs
Binary: kdelibs-bin kdelibs kdelibs4-doc kdelibs4c2 kdelibs4c2-dbg kdelibs-data kdelibs4-dev
Architecture: source i386 all
Version: 4:3.4.2-1
Distribution: unstable
Urgency: low
Maintainer: Debian Qt/KDE Maintainers <debian-qt-kde@lists.debian.org>
Changed-By: Debian Qt/KDE Maintainers <debian-qt-kde@lists.debian.org>
Description: 
 kdelibs    - core libraries from the official KDE release
 kdelibs-bin - core binaries for all KDE applications
 kdelibs-data - core shared data for all KDE applications
 kdelibs4-dev - development files for the KDE core libraries
 kdelibs4-doc - developer documentation for the KDE core libraries
 kdelibs4c2 - core libraries for all KDE applications
 kdelibs4c2-dbg - debugging symbols for kdelibs4c2
Closes: 257588 268659 283858 285882 287822 288900 292084 307098 311958 317543 318017 319154 320450 323093
Changes: 
 kdelibs (4:3.4.2-1) unstable; urgency=low
 .
   * New upstream release. Includes a forward declaration of KXMLGUIClient in
     kactioncollection.h, which makes gcc-4.0 happy and thus closes: #317543,
     #318017, #319154, #323093 (arson, smb4k, kile and amarok FTBFS).
 .
   * KDE_3_4_BRANCH update.
 .
   +++ Changes by Christopher Martin:
 .
   * GCC 4.0 transition: kdelibs4 becomes kdelibs4c2. Tighten build depends on
     libarts1-dev, libqt3-mt-dev, libfam-dev, libtiff4-dev, and libopenexr-dev
     to ensure that we build against transitioned packages.
 .
     Since kdelibs4 now depends on libopenexr2c2, this upload closes: #320450.
 .
   * Make kdelibs4 always depend on the identical version of kdelibs-data.
     (Closes: #311958)
 .
   +++ Changes by Adeodato Simó:
 .
   * Remove obsolete conflicts/replaces relationships against packages/versions
     not present in Sarge.
 .
 kdelibs (4:3.4.1-1) experimental; urgency=low
 .
   * New upstream release.
 .
 kdelibs (4:3.4.0-0pre5) alioth; urgency=low
 .
   * New upstream release.
 .
   * KDE_3_4_BRANCH update.
 .
   * Bugs reported in the Debian BTS fixed by this release:
 .
     - no longer FTBFS on amd64/gcc-4.0. (Closes: #288900)
 .
   * Converted packaging to CDBS (initial version by Daniel Schepler, further
     changes by Christopher Martin and Adeodato Simó).
 .
   +++ Changes by Adeodato Simó:
 .
   * Added new package kdelibs4-dbg, with separate debugging symbols. Added
     Build-Dependency on binutils (>= 2.14.90.0.7) as per the dh_strip man
     page. (Closes: #257588).
 .
   * [cdbs/kde.mk] Use escaped variables in the definitions of kde_htmldir and
     the like instead of absolute paths, so that /usr/bin/kde-config doesn't
     output them expanded even when --expandvars is not used. (Closes: #287822)
 .
   * Fixed the ability of the build system to find kde.pot, even when it is not
     located at KDEDIR/include/kde.pot. This allows the use of targets such as
     "package-messages" without specifying includedir. (Closes: #283858)
 .
   * Now that graphviz is in main, add it to Build-Depends-Indep together with
     gsfonts-x11 to generate diagrams in the API documentation.
 .
   +++ Changes by Christopher Martin
 .
   * Adjust the placement of the merging of the Debian menu in
     applications.menu. Oddly enough, this seems to work around some issues
     with io slaves and remote file access.
 .
   * Rename applications.menu to kde-applications.menu, avoiding a conflict
     with the new GNOME xdg menu files. (Closes: #307098)
 .
   * Debianize the Konqueror browser's user-agent string. (Closes: #268659)
 .
   * Tighten libart-2.0-dev build dependency. (Closes: #285882)
 .
   * Clean out useless manpages. New or better ones welcome...
     (Closes: #292084)
Files: 
 cfe3f8f20766fffdd8ca46e8c1131686 1475 libs optional kdelibs_3.4.2-1.dsc
 ce94fad0e1e87f95d73ec8dceb2fca31 20059698 libs optional kdelibs_3.4.2.orig.tar.gz
 b149b64d12cca117668e071f17e19ce6 363845 libs optional kdelibs_3.4.2-1.diff.gz
 ce3b9cb772073f83f631825601b8d5fd 29082 kde optional kdelibs_3.4.2-1_all.deb
 affdccc472b6c99296b422d73f1d1969 8128744 libs optional kdelibs-data_3.4.2-1_all.deb
 82f37a9df96785e24bf94b5ca901be23 31820178 doc optional kdelibs4-doc_3.4.2-1_all.deb
 4dfad931a793cde7946350eba8ba22c8 833706 libs optional kdelibs-bin_3.4.2-1_i386.deb
 06951cf0a5f167c6275a60cb223eb403 8214552 libs optional kdelibs4c2_3.4.2-1_i386.deb
 279348ea4ae4dc27ffb73871a7472400 1342764 libdevel optional kdelibs4-dev_3.4.2-1_i386.deb
 a28628aea6c5a58474ea7e01948460b3 19699656 libdevel extra kdelibs4c2-dbg_3.4.2-1_i386.deb
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.1 (GNU/Linux)
Comment: Signed by Adeodato Simó <asp16@alu.ua.es>
iEYEARECAAYFAkMC9OQACgkQgyNlRdHEGILHLACglcxup3OxZSZAU89rC+Yef3qg
JPYAn0+5DUDftP8DBtBkSxIc57ndaH+F
=e7Cg
-----END PGP SIGNATURE-----
Reply to: